    Sujet
    This product is purified RNase A isolated from bovine pancreas. RNase A is an endoribonuclease that exists as a single chain polypeptide containing 4 disulphide bridges. It can be inhibited by alkylation of the histidine-12 or histidine-119 that is present in the active site. Activators of RNase A include potassium and sodium salts. The optimal conditions for activity are 60°C and pH 7.6. Its molecular weight is 13.7 kDa, and activity is 85-140 U/mg protein.
